TDAQ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

12 of the 8,128 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in TappAlpha Innovation 100 Growth & Daily Income ETF (TDAQ)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$28.7M — up 1,854% from $1.47M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 7 funds opened new TDAQ posit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 4 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Clear Street, opening a new position worth an estimated $20.5M.
